The effect of selected factors on potato tuber density

abstract: The work presents an analysis of potato tuber density change taking into account the impact of many factors. The tests were performed using a method involving density assessment with reference to single tubers. The examination covered two tuber fractions, three potato varieties, fertilised with mineral and pro-ecological fertilizers. The measurements were taken for eight months, in one-month intervals. The tests were carried out between 2001 and 2004. The results prove that all the factors assumed in the experiment had statistically significant effect on the density value. Higher density was discovered in smaller tubers, after vegetation in insufficient rainwater amount conditions, fertilised with mineral fertilizers. Tuber density was increasing during extended storage periods, and the course of these changes was expressed with second degree polynomial equations.
